I did Photo pass when I went to WDW in 2009 and I remember paying $99 and getting a CD with all my pics. Is that pretty much what the PhotoPass+ does at disneyland?
 
Yes. PhotoPass+ will also include ride photos and certain character meal photos. I can't believe I forgot to pre-order mine for this weekend. D'OH!
 
I believe that PP+ also includes stock photos of DLR for you to use in scrap books, etc. And since you will own all the pics once you pay for the CD, you will be able to go somewhere less expensive than Disney (e.g. Target, Snapfish, etc.) to make photo albums for all the kids on your trip.
 

You can get a CD or download the pictures to your computer if you don't want to wait for the CD to arrive.
 
We got the CD for our pictures on our December trip. It's actually a very good deal!

You need to order 14 days before your trip. You will get a CD in the mail with stock photos. It also has a redemption certificate to bring to the parks to get your lanyard to use getting photos in the parks. Inside that CD case is a redemption certificate to use when you are home and done editing your photos and ready to order your CD. (or download).

And don't forget to edit your photos (add borders, etc) before adding the CD/download to your cart. Once you add it, you can't go back and edit the photos. So for me, I had about 5 copies of every photo! (plain, 2-3 different borders, character autograph, etc) Then just downloaded all of them and printed out certain ones later.
